Transaction 623141c756c2c3409b59dc98c7b4f98e3b8664e7413ccac20d73465b21a46565

1 Input
2 Outputs
  • 623141c756c2c3409b59dc98c7b4f98e3b8664e7413ccac20d73465b21a46565:0
  • value  433159365
    address  14xVu1X4LJXDndLTyGFFnRCkUoEX3susHS
  • 623141c756c2c3409b59dc98c7b4f98e3b8664e7413ccac20d73465b21a46565:1
  • value  4288000
    address  357j3P2CuybfWh13V4uig9TJDJdqiR8CMx